办公小浣熊
Raccoon - AI 智能助手

知识库的热词推荐功能是如何实现的?

当我们沉浸在知识的海洋中,有时会遇到一种情况:面对一个庞大的知识库,却不知道从哪里开始寻找自己需要的信息。这种感觉就像走进一个巨大的图书馆,却没有目录索引,只能盲目地穿梭在书架之间。这时,如果有一个智能的助手能主动为我们推荐当前最相关、最热门的关键词,搜索效率将会大大提升。这正是知识库热词推荐功能的价值所在——它仿佛一位贴心的向导,不仅能理解你的潜在需求,还能洞察整个知识体系的动态变化,将最有可能对你有所帮助的词汇呈现在眼前。以小浣熊AI助手为例,这项功能让知识获取的过程不再是单向的、被动的查询,而变成了一种交互式的、主动的发现体验。

功能核心:理解推荐逻辑

热词推荐并非简单地将出现频率最高的词罗列出来。它的核心逻辑是一个多因素综合决策的过程。首要任务是理解用户的“意图”和知识的“热度”。这就像一位经验丰富的图书管理员,他不仅要熟悉每本书的内容(知识本身),还要观察近期哪些书籍被借阅最频繁、哪些话题在读者讨论中最火热(热度趋势),同时还要结合询问者的大致背景和过往兴趣(用户画像),才能给出最精准的推荐。

具体来说,小浣熊AI助手的推荐引擎会实时分析海量用户的行为数据。例如,当一个“项目管理”相关的文档被大量集中访问和搜索时,系统会迅速捕捉到这一信号。同时,引擎还会分析文档内容之间的关联性。如果一篇关于“敏捷开发”的文档与“项目管理”文档被大量用户在同一会话中浏览,那么“敏捷开发”也会被识别为相关热词。这种“行为热度”“语义关联”相结合的方式,确保了推荐结果不仅是流行的,更是上下文相关的。

数据分析:挖掘词汇价值

数据的背后隐藏着用户需求的密码。热词推荐功能依赖强大的数据分析能力,这些数据主要分为两大类:显性数据和隐性数据。

  • 显性数据:这类数据直接反映了用户的主动行为。主要包括:搜索查询记录(用户输入了哪些关键词)、文档点击率(哪些知识条目最受关注)、以及用户的主动标记(如收藏、点赞)。这些是判断一个词汇是否“热”的最直观证据。
  • 隐性数据:这类数据更为深层,需要算法去挖掘。例如,用户在某个知识页面上的停留时长,反映了内容的吸引力和价值;用户浏览的路径序列(例如,先看了A文档,紧接着又看了B文档),揭示了知识之间的内在联系;甚至搜索无结果后的行为,也能帮助系统发现知识库的空白或用户潜在的、未被满足的需求。

小浣熊AI助手通过整合这些多维度的数据,构建出一个动态的“知识热度图谱”。这个图谱不仅记录了每个词汇的瞬时热度,还能分析其热度的变化趋势(是处于上升期、平稳期还是衰退期),从而能够预测哪些知识领域即将成为焦点,实现前瞻性的推荐。

算法应用:智能匹配的关键

算法是热词推荐功能的“大脑”。现代知识库系统通常采用多种算法模型协同工作,以实现最佳的推荐效果。

最基础的是基于统计的算法,例如TF-IDF(词频-逆文档频率)。它可以识别出在特定文档中频繁出现,但在整个知识库中并不常见的词汇,这些词汇往往是能代表该文档核心内容的关键词。然而,单纯的统计方法无法理解语义。为此,更先进的语义理解算法被广泛应用,如Word2Vec、BERT等模型。这些模型能够理解“电脑”和“计算机”是相似的概念,即使它们字面上完全不同。小浣熊AI助手就深度融合了这类技术,使得推荐能够超越字面匹配,达到语义层面的关联。

此外,协同过滤的思想也被借鉴过来。简单来说,就是“物以类聚,人以群分”。如果发现用户A和用户B的历史行为非常相似,而用户A最近频繁搜索某个关键词,那么系统就会将这个关键词推荐给用户B。这种群体智慧的运用,极大地丰富了推荐的多样性和准确性。

用户体验:简洁而强大的交互

再强大的后台功能,最终都需要通过直观友好的界面呈现给用户。热词推荐的交互设计遵循“少即是多”的原则,旨在不干扰用户主要任务的前提下,提供恰到好处的帮助。

最常见的呈现方式是在搜索框下方或结果页的侧边栏,以一个简洁的“热门搜索”或“相关推荐”列表出现。这些词汇通常以标签云的形式展示,字号大小直观地反映了热度的差异。当用户将鼠标悬浮在某个热词上时,小浣熊AI助手可能会提供一小段该词的释义或相关的文档数量预览,帮助用户快速判断这是否是自己想要的内容。

这种设计极大地降低了用户的认知负荷。用户无需费力思考该用什么关键词,只需轻轻点击,就能快速切入相关的知识领域。它尤其适合两种场景:一是当用户只有模糊需求,无法准确描述时,热词可以作为探索的起点;二是当用户想了解某一领域的最新动态或焦点时,热词列表提供了一个快速的风向标。

优化与挑战:持续的进化之路

没有任何一个系统是完美无缺的,热词推荐功能也在不断优化中面临挑战。一个常见的挑战是“马太效应”,即热词会因为被推荐而获得更多点击,从而变得更热,这可能导致一些有价值但相对冷门的内容永远无法进入用户的视野。为了应对这一点,小浣熊AI助手的算法中引入了“探索与利用”的平衡机制,偶尔会推荐一些新兴的、有潜力的词汇,以促进知识发现的多样性。

另一个挑战是冷启动问题。对于一个全新的知识库或一个新用户,由于缺乏足够的历史数据,推荐系统很难在初期做出精准的判断。解决的办法通常是引入基于内容的推荐作为初始策略,并随着数据的积累逐步切换到更复杂的混合推荐模式。此外,语义理解技术的不断进步,也让系统对新鲜词汇和复杂概念的处理能力越来越强。

热词推荐功能面临的挑战与应对策略
挑战 描述 应对策略
马太效应 热门内容越来越热,冷门内容被忽略。 引入多样性机制,主动推荐潜力词汇。
冷启动问题 新系统或新用户缺乏数据进行精准推荐。 采用基于内容的初始推荐,逐步过渡。
语义歧义 同一词汇在不同语境下有不同含义。 利用上下文信息进行语义消歧。

未来展望:更智能的知识导航

展望未来,知识库的热词推荐功能将朝着更加智能化、个性化的方向发展。随着自然语言处理和知识图谱技术的成熟,未来的推荐将不再是孤立的关键词,而是相互关联的“概念网络”。小浣熊AI助手或许能够根据你正在阅读的文档,动态地生成一个围绕核心主题的知识地图,直观展示相关概念及其关系,引导你进行系统性的学习。

更深层次的个性化也是重要方向。系统将不仅能理解你的显性需求,还能通过持续学习你的行为模式,洞察你的知识背景和学习目标,从而为你量身定制独一无二的热词列表,真正成为你的个人知识导航员。同时,随着多模态交互的普及,语音指令、手势操作等也可能成为触发热词推荐的新方式,使人机交互更加自然流畅。

总而言之,知识库的热词推荐功能是一个融合了数据分析、人工智能和用户体验设计的复杂系统。它通过智能算法洞察知识的热点与关联,并以简洁的方式赋能用户,极大地提升了知识获取的效率和体验。正如小浣熊AI助手所努力的方向,这项功能的终极目标,是让每个人都能轻松地与知识对话,在信息的海洋中精准地找到属于自己的那座灯塔。对于知识库的运营者而言,持续关注算法的公平性、推荐的explanation(可解释性)以及用户隐私保护,将是推动这项技术健康发展的关键。

小浣熊家族 Raccoon - AI 智能助手 - 商汤科技

办公小浣熊是商汤科技推出的AI办公助手,办公小浣熊2.0版本全新升级

代码小浣熊办公小浣熊